Hello all,

Four Minutes to Midnight is now accepting poetry, prose and visual
art submissions for its 9th issue, due out this fall. We've had great
success and feedback from our last two issues, with interest and
support coming from a wide-ranging and eclectic community of artists.
We expect issue 9 to carry this momentum forward into new creative
territory.

Given the collaborative, experimental and often 'accidental' nature
of Four Minutes to Midnight, we've found that a succinct description
of the zine is always a little hard to come by. If you'd like to
submit some work, please take the time to peruse previous issues
(available for download in pdf format at www.lokidesign.net
documents.html) to get an idea of what we're about. If you're
interested in what we're doing, then we'll most likely be interested
in your work. As a general rule, we're looking for work that is both
personal and political, work that explores our concept of language,
and ideas that aren't seen as too precious to be tossed around and
played with a bit.

This time around though, in order to get ideas moving faster, we've
decided to loosely theme the issue around the concept of conflict and
silence. A bit cheesy, and a bit melodramatic to be sure, but I think
they're broad concepts that can be expressed in any number of
interesting ways.

This is, as always, an interactive and collaborative project, so in
addition to the submitted work, there's a discussion thread on the
2356 blog, a "fugue", that will be used to generate text(ural)
content for the issue. It can be found here:

http://lokidesign.net/2356/2007/03/issue-09-keep-walking.html

We'll be weaving submitted content with that thread to create
something that will hopefully capture the "dialogue" between us on
this site, in our own lives and in our creative work.
